On the secular evolution of the semi-major axis in canonical formalism

Earth and Planetary Astrophysics 2025-05-02 v1

Abstract

There are several astrophysical configurations where one is interested only in the long-term dynamical evolution. Although the first-order version of this approximation is usually sufficient in applications, second-order corrections may be relevant, too. Here we use the Hamiltonian formalism to show how such higher-order terms lead to the long-term evolution of the semi-major axis.
